86h

Bracknell Forest Transport Plan 3 Core Strategy pdf icon PDF 94 KB

To adopt the Local Transport Plan 3 (LTP3) Core Strategy and its supporting documentation, and to roll forward a selection of LTP2 strategies.

 

The Appendix 3 – LTP3 Strategic Environmental Assessment (SEA),  Appendix 4 – LTP3 Habitats Regulation Assessment (HRA), and Appendix 5 – LTP3 Background Paper will be available online only.

Additional documents:

Minutes:

RESOLVED that

 

1          The adoption of the Local Transport Plan 3 Core Strategy (Appendix 1), the Statement of Consultation (Appendix 2) and the Associated Supporting Documents (Appendices 3, 4 and 5) be recommended to Council.      

 

2          The Integrated Transport Capital programme for 2011/12 (Appendix 6) be approved by the Executive subject to expenditure on the S106 programme not exceeding £750k without full Council approval of additional funds.

 

3          The additional draw down of £400k of Section 106 as shown be recommended to Council.

 

4          Authority be delegated to the Executive Member for Planning and Transport and Economic Development to agree any necessary minor amendments to the Local Transport Plan 3 Core Strategy (Appendix 1) and supporting documents prior to publication for adoption.

 

5          The indicative Highway Maintenance Works Programmes for the financial year 2011-2012 be approved, as set out in Appendix 7 to the report as the basis for targeting available maintenance funds.

86i

Affordable Housing Planning Policy pdf icon PDF 99 KB

To clarify the Council’s planning policy on affordable housing in view of the publication of various national and local policy documents since the adoption of the Bracknell Forest Borough Local Plan (BFBLP) in 2002 and the publication of Affordable Housing from Residential Development Supplementary Planning Guidance (SPG) that was approved by the Council’s Executive in 2003.

Minutes:

RESOLVED that

 

1          The Affordable Housing from Residential Development Supplementary Planning Guidance that was originally approved by the Council’s Executive on 16 September 2003 be revoked.

 

2          The reliance on saved Policy H8 of the Bracknell Forest Borough Local Plan (2002) together with the Council’s Housing Strategy and Planning Policy Statement 3 (2010) to seek a target percentage of provision up to 25% (subject to viability) and use of the national indicative minimum site size threshold (15 net), respectively be confirmed.

 

4          The approach outlined in 2.2 of the report, be included in an update of the Council's Housing Strategy.

 

5          The affordable housing on qualifying sites will be delivered in accordance with the delivery model set out in the Affordable Homes Programme Framework 2011-2015 (February 2011) or as subsequently updated be confirmed. This included the new affordable rent product, and, low cost home ownership such as shared ownership.
